Empowering Communities: Solar Milestones from Schools to Sustainability

Welcome to our latest update! Thanks to your support and our successful year-end fundraiser, we're not only celebrating recent achievements but also looking forward to new ventures that promise to extend our impact. Here's where we stand and what's on the horizon:

  • Schools Aglow: Our solar schools program has brightened six more educational institutions, creating enriched learning environments for students.
  • Water for Life: This month, we're installing our first solar water pumping and filtration system in Chennai, thanks to the Brother's Brother Foundation. Additionally, as part of our solar schools and clinics program, three more water filtration systems, funded by Grand Circle Foundation, are set to provide clean drinking water for two schools and one clinic.
  • Puerto Rico's Progress: Our flagship project in Puerto Rico, also backed by Brother's Brother Foundation, begins installation on Monday, marking a major leap in our renewable energy efforts.

What's Next:

  • Expanding Education: With the generous support of Saxo Bank, we're gearing up to launch another solar school project next month, furthering our mission to illuminate educational paths.
  • Safe Streets: Our pilot Solar Street Lighting Program is set to improve community safety and connectivity, bringing sustainable light to public spaces.
  • Empowering Women in Solar: In collaboration with Bindi International and with support from the Foundation For Sustainable Innovation and ERM Foundation, we're excited to initiate the Women in Solar Training Program. This initiative is designed to empower women with essential solar energy skills, fostering gender equality and enhancing community sustainability.
